Gene name Cht11
Flybase description The gene Cht11 is referred to in FlyBase by the symbol Dmel\Cht11 (CG3044, FBgn0029913).

Gene details (from Flybase) It is a protein_coding_gene from Drosophila melanogaster.
Based on sequence similarity, it is predicted to have molecular function: chitinase activity.
An electronic pipeline based on InterPro domains suggests that it is involved in the biological process: chitin catabolic process.
2 alleles are reported.
No phenotypic data is available.
It has one annotated transcript and one annotated polypeptide.
Protein features are: Chitinase II; Glycoside hydrolase, chitinase active site; Glycoside hydrolase, family 18, catalytic domain; Glycoside hydrolase, subgroup, catalytic core; Glycoside hydrolase, superfamily.
Summary of modENCODE Temporal Expression Profile: Temporal profile ranges from a peak of moderately high expression to a trough of low expression.
Peak expression observed within 00-06 hour embryonic stages, during late larval stages, during early pupal stages.
